Immune responses in BALB/c mice following immunization with aromatic compound or purine-dependent Salmonella typhimurium strains.
Immunology - 1 Feb 1990
O'Callaghan D, Maskell D, Tite J, Dougan G
Abstract excerpt
Two near isogenic strains of Salmonella typhimurium HWSH, stably mutated in either the aroA gene affecting the biosynthesis of aromatic compounds, or the purA gene affecting the biosynthesis of purines, were administered intravenously as live attenuated vaccines to BALB/c mice.
